A REDDITCH printing firm has ambitious expansion plans after finding a new headquarters. 

Webb Print and Display have found a new home on North Moons Moat industrial estate after help from commercial property agents John Truslove.

The company saved five jobs from a previous printing firm and has grown to employ ten people so far.

Owner Michael Corless now has plans to expand the business to employ 20 to 25 people within the next few years.

“Our original plan to buy an existing firm fell through so we started last summer as a completely new business,” said Mike.

“I’d worked with Ben Truslove at John Truslove before.

“He helped us look at nine or ten premises around the Redditch area.

“We put offers in on two and successfully secured a five-year lease on 10 Colemeadow Road, on North Moons Moat industrial estate.

“From start to finish we had the keys in about a month, which enabled us to get off to a rapid start installing presses, laminators and other equipment.”

Mike added: “We’re now in a position to scale up the business and we are starting to target local businesses and companies across the region as new customers to help with our growth.

“We believe there is an enormous opportunity for us here.”

Mr Corless is predicting a first full year turnover of £1.5m to £1.8m and aims to grow the business to a £4m to £5m company.

Ben Truslove, joint managing director at John Truslove, said: “Mike and Webb P&D are a great new tenant for our landlord client.

“Mike has a wealth of experience in the printing industry and a clear plan to expand the business and create jobs for skilled local people.”
